What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Consumer Reviewer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Consumer Reviewer,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and excellent written communication, often supported by experience in product testing or journalism. Familiarity with online review platforms, content management systems, and sometimes SEO tools is typically required. Objectivity, integrity, and the ability to provide constructive feedback are essential soft skills in this role. These skills ensure reviews are credible, informative, and helpful for consumers making purchasing decisions.

What are some common challenges faced by Consumer Review professionals and how can they be addressed?

Consumer Review professionals often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of feedback, identifying genuine reviews amidst potential spam, and maintaining objectivity when evaluating diverse consumer experiences. To address these challenges, it's important to implement robust review moderation tools, establish clear guidelines for assessing review authenticity, and develop effective communication skills to handle both positive and negative feedback. Collaborating closely with customer service and quality assurance teams also helps ensure that insights from reviews lead to meaningful improvements.

What are consumer review jobs?

Consumer review jobs involve evaluating products, services, or experiences and providing feedback, often in the form of written reviews or ratings. People in this role may be hired by companies, brands, or third-party platforms to test new offerings and share their honest opinions. The goal is to help companies improve their products and assist other consumers in making informed decisions. Consumer review jobs can range from part-time gigs to full-time positions, and sometimes offer free products or compensation for your time.
